教你一招:如何快速启动FTP服务器 命令启动ftp服务器

   搜狗SEO    

在当今现代网络环境中,文件传输协议(FTP)服务器扮演着至关重要的角色,用于在不同计算机之间快速、高效地传输文件。要启动FTP服务器可能看起来需要一些配置和准备工作,但其实通过简单的命令行操作,你就可以迅速搭建一个基本的FTP服务器。接下来我们将详细介绍如何进行这一操作:

安装FTP服务器软件

FTP服务器

在开始之前,确保你的系统上已经安装了适用于FTP服务器的软件。对于Linux系统而言,vsftpd是一个常用的选择;而在Windows系统中,你可以选择使用内建的IIS服务或者第三方软件如FileZilla Server。

配置文件准备

FTP服务器通常需要一个配置文件来定义其各项行为,这个配置文件包含了服务器的各种设置,比如监听地址、用户权限、目录结构等。

启动FTP服务器

一旦FTP服务器软件安装完成,并且配置文件准备就绪,你就可以通过命令行简单快速地启动FTP服务器。

在Linux系统启动FTP服务器

1. 打开终端。

2. 输入以下命令以检查vsftpd是否已安装:

sudo systemctl status vsftpd

3. 如果vsftpd未安装,使用包管理器安装它。在Ubuntu系统上,你可以使用以下命令:

sudo apt-get update

sudo apt-get install vsftpd

4. 创建或编辑vsftpd的配置文件:

sudo nano /etc/vsftpd.conf

Linux FTP服务器

5. 根据需要修改配置文件。

6. 保存并退出编辑器。

7. 重启vsftpd服务以应用更改:

sudo systemctl restart vsftpd

8. 使用以下命令启动FTP服务器:

sudo systemctl start vsftpd

9. 若要使FTP服务器随系统启动自动运行,使用:

sudo systemctl enable vsftpd

在Windows系统启动FTP服务器

1. 打开命令提示符。

2. 如果你使用的是IIS,可以通过“控制面板” > “程序” > “打开或关闭Windows功能”来安装FTP服务。

3. 安装完成后,使用以下命令启动FTP服务:

Windows FTP服务器

net start ftpsvc

4. 若要使FTP服务器随系统启动自动运行,使用:

net start ftpsvc

安全性考虑

当使用FTP服务器时,安全性至关重要。确保选择安全版本的FTP(如FTPS或SFTP),并为服务器配置正确的防火墙规则。定期更新FTP服务器软件以确保应用了最新的安全补丁,以提升安全性。

监控和维护

一旦FTP服务器正常运行,务必定期监控其性能和安全状态。包括检查日志文件、确保没有未经授权的访问、以及监控系统资源的使用情况。

相关问题与解答

1. 问:我如何知道FTP服务器是否已经成功启动?

答:你可以通过在命令行中执行systemctl status vsftpd(Linux)或net start ftpsvc(Windows)来检查FTP服务器的状态。

2. 问:我应该如何选择FTP服务器软件?

答:选择FTP服务器软件时,考虑你的操作系统、安全性需求、易用性和社区支持等因素。

3. 问:如何配置FTP用户的权限?

答:通常可以在FTP服务器的配置文件中设置用户权限,或通过管理界面进行权限配置。

4. 问:我怎样才能提高FTP服务器的安全性?

答:使用安全版本的FTP(如FTPS或SFTP),配置防火墙规则,定期更新软件,以及实施强密码策略等方法可以提高FTP服务器的安全性。

以上是关于启动FTP服务器的详细步骤和技术介绍,希望对你有所帮助。如有任何疑问或建议,请留言并与我们分享。

感谢观看!记得评论、关注、点赞哦!

评论留言

我要留言

欢迎参与讨论,请在这里发表您的看法、交流您的观点。